Kenya vs Morocco prediction

Kenya are currently sitting one point above Morocco at the top of Group A having played a game more, beating DR Congo by a goal to nil and drawing 1-1 with Angola. Meanwhile, Morocco were fairly comfortable winners in their only group match so far, defeating Angola 2-0 in Nairobi and can move above Kenya with victory here.

However, breaking down Kenya will be a tougher task for Morocco, especially with the former likely to deploy a defensive style of play that prioritises keeping bodies behind the ball and not taking many risks, knowing that a draw would keep them top of the table. Therefore, expect a tight encounter and backing these two nations to not be separated should be seriously considered.
